Non-Laser Vision Adjustment Techniques



Taking into consideration choices to LASIK, non-laser vision correction techniques use alternatives for people seeking vision enhancement without going through laser surgery.

One common non-laser strategy is Orthokeratology, where special contact lenses are put on over night to improve the cornea temporarily, giving more clear vision throughout the day. This method can be ideal for those who are hesitant concerning permanent surgical changes to their eyes.

An additional alternative is PRK (Photorefractive Keratectomy), a surgical procedure that improves the cornea without creating a flap, making it a selection for people with slim corneas or those in jeopardy for eye injuries.

In addition, phakic intraocular lenses can be dental implanted in the eye to correct vision, suitable for those with high refractive errors.

These non-laser alternatives may be worth checking out if you're seeking vision correction yet favor to prevent LASIK surgery. Consulting with an eye care expert can assist determine the best option tailored to your particular requirements.

Implantable Contact Lenses



Implantable contact lenses use a potential solution for vision adjustment without the need for laser surgical procedure. These lenses, also known as phakic intraocular lenses, are operatively put inside the eye before the all-natural lens. They function similarly to routine contact lenses however are positioned within the eye, making them unnoticeable to others.

This alternative is ideal for individuals with high refractive errors who may not appropriate candidates for LASIK or various other laser treatments. Implantable get in touch with lenses can correct a range of vision concerns, consisting of nearsightedness, farsightedness, and astigmatism.

The treatment for implanting these lenses is relatively fast and minimally intrusive, with several patients experiencing enhanced vision promptly after surgical treatment. While there are dangers connected with any kind of procedure, implantable get in touch with lenses have actually revealed to be a safe and reliable lasting service for vision adjustment.



If you're thinking about alternate options to LASIK and like not to undergo laser surgery, implantable get in touch with lenses could be a viable selection worth checking out with your eye care service provider.
